This statistic represents the difficulty rating of recruiting specific skills and experiences in the Fintech industry in the United Kingdom (UK). Respondents to the survey were asked which skills or experiences were hardest to recruit in the Fintech industry. It can be seen that software engineering, systems architecture and developmentwas deemed to be the hardest skill to recruit for in the Fintech sector whereas financial and tax was the easiest.
FinTech industry: distribution of the hardest skills and experience to recruit for employment in the United Kingdom (UK) in 2019
